HU14 3QG maps, stats, and open data

HU14 3QG lies on Chantry Way East in Swanland, North Ferriby. HU14 3QG is located in the South Hunsley electoral ward, within the unitary authority of East Riding of Yorkshire and the English Parliamentary constituency of Haltemprice and Howden. The Sub Integrated Care Board (ICB) Location is NHS Humber and North Yorkshire ICB - 02Y and the police force is Humberside. This postcode has been in use since January 1980.
